What are some jazz albums with amazing piano playing?
>>71019771
Art Tatum- Solo Masterpieces Vol. 1
Bud Powell- Jazz Giant
Ahmad Jamal- Live at the Pershing
Bill Evans- The Village Vanguard Recordings
Oscar Peterson- Tristeza on Piano
Herbie Hancock- Maiden Voyage
Jaki Byard- Quartet Live!
Chick Corea- Now He Sings, Now He Sobs
Keith Jarrett- Life Between the Exit Signs
Ray Brown Trio- Soular Energy
Fred Hersch- Sarabande
Simon Nabatov- Sneak Preview
Brad Mehldau- Art of the Trio Vol. 2
George Colligan- The Newcomer
Dave Kikoski- Consequences
Luis Perdomo- Links
